How full should I keep my SSD?
You should leave 10-25% of your SSD free for optimal performance, longevity, and system stability, allowing space for wear leveling, garbage collection, and OS updates, with 20% being a strong, common recommendation, though some modern drives handle less, while more space (closer to 30%) is better for QLC drives or heavy use.How full should you keep your SSD?
The operating system needs around 20% of the SSD space to be free for it to function properly. If you find yourself with a “Disk Full” error message or experience poor performance due to insufficient space on your SSD, you're not the only one!Do SSDs run slower when full?
Yes, SSDs slow down when they get full because they need free space for background tasks like garbage collection and SLC caching, and with less room, the drive must erase and rewrite entire blocks of data, significantly increasing overhead and reducing write speeds, especially over 80-90% capacity. Keeping 10-20% of the drive free is recommended for optimal performance.How many GB should you leave free?

Why does my 512GB SSD show 476 GB?
Your 512GB SSD shows around 476GB because manufacturers use decimal (base-10) for marketing (1GB = 1,000,000,000 bytes), while Windows uses binary (base-2) for reporting (1GB = 1024MB), and the SSD uses space for firmware and file system overhead, so the math results in less usable space. It's a normal difference, not a faulty drive, as the operating system converts the manufacturer's measurement, resulting in the smaller number.Is 2TB SSD overkill?

A larger SSD capacity means more erase blocks, thereby reducing the frequency each block is erased and, thereby, increasing the life of the SSD. On the other hand, as the number of writes increases, the SSD will slow and its lifespan will shorten.Why is 2TB SSD only 1.81 TB?
Storage is calculated differently Manufacturers use decimal (base 10): 1 TB = 1,000,000,000,000 bytes Your computer uses binary (base 2): 1 TB = 1,099,511,627,776 bytes So when your system reads that "2 trillion bytes," it sees it as ~1.81 TB, not a full 2 TB.Is SSD better than RAM?
